Does Linux have D drive?

Linux (Unix generally) does not have drive letters – that’s purely a windows (ms-dos) thing. You can try lsblk or df ( df -h) cmds to see drive & dir mounts or look in /etc/fstab. You should tell us exactly where you got that info from and what you are trying to do.

Does Linux have drives like Windows?

Originally Answered: Why does Linux not have drive letters like Windows does? Because they are not needed. In general, Linux views everything as a file. Drives or drive partitions are mounted to a folder.
